This position will assist with the enablement and adoption of Co-Pilot and AI-driven analytics tools, contribute to the development of interactive analytics features such as writeback and user-defined functions, and support the evaluation of new and preview analytics capabilities. The role emphasizes learning, collaboration, and practical application of analytics tools to help business teams access and use data effectively.
The ideal candidate is technically curious, eager to learn, detail-oriented, and motivated to grow their analytics skillset while contributing to meaningful, real-world business solutions.
Primary Responsibilities
- Facilitate the configuration, training, and ongoing improvement of Co-Pilot within our analytics environment
- Assist with user enablement by helping develop training, example prompts, and basic use cases for Co-Pilot/ AI tools
- Build and maintain analytics solutions under guidance, including reports, dashboards, and interactive features
- Assist in the development and maintenance of user-defined functions (UDFs) and writeback workflows as directed
- Apply data visualization best practices to reports and dashboards to ensure clarity and usability
- Help maintain documentation, metadata definitions, and data catalogs to support data literacy and transparency
- Facilitate Analytics Center of Excellence (CoE) activities, including knowledge sharing and enablement sessions
- Gather and document requirements and support communication between stakeholders and technical teams
